Yellow tungsten oxide may be used to prepare a nano transparent heat insulation coating, which is a new energy-saving coating prepared by high-tech nanotechnology. It is also an environmentally friendly coating that can shield both ultraviolet rays and near-infrared rays. Therefore, the heat insulation effect is obvious. And thus it can be applied to architectural glass to reduce building energy consumption and ultimately achieve the purpose of energy conservation and emission reduction.

As you may have known, there are three conventional methods to solve the heat insulation problem of door and window glass including heat insulating film, heat reflecting film and LOW-E glass. But the heat insulating coating of tungsten oxide nanoparticles does not have the disadvantages of poor light transmission and easy light pollution. In addition, the environmentally-friendly transparent heat-insulating coating can instantly cure the coating under the action of ultraviolet light. Moreover, such coating has the characteristics of high production efficiency, low energy consumption and environmental protection. And therefore it has broad market prospects.
